The rosemary and lemon combination, which I love in savory dishes (like roasted chicken with lemon and rosemary) works really well in a desert too! The rosemary gives it a subtle flavor and aroma and looks really pretty in the fodant. THe people I made it for commented on the unique flavors and really liked it. I found the cake a little heartier than I expected. I would recommend it as a brunch cake instead of as an after-dinner dessert. Great recipe!
